Two men were killed Monday in a shooting at a Bolingbrook industrial park, authorities said.
Bolingbrook police were called at 9:39 a.m. with a report of a shooting at YCB International, an auto supply importer, in the 600 block of Veterans Parkway, said Lt. Carter Larry, a police spokesman.
Larry said three employees were in the business at the time of the shooting. Two were not injured.
The Will County coroner hotline said Xinling Zhang, 39, of Naperville, suffered multiple gunshots and was pronounced dead at 12:20 p.m. Degang Zhang, 48, of Aurora, suffered a single gunshot wound and was pronounced dead at noon, the coroner hotline said. Both men died at the scene, and autopsies are scheduled for Tuesday, the coroner said.
Larry said the gun in the incident was recovered, and there was no threat to the public.
Four Bolingbrook schools were on soft lockdown for a short time because of the incident, the Valley View School District 365U website said.
The schools affected were Bolingbrook High School, Jane Addams Middle School, Independence Elementary School and Oak View Elementary School. Bolingbrook High School is about a half-mile east of where the shooting took place.
A soft lockdown meant staff and students in the buildings were following procedures designed to maintain a safe school environment. All doors were locked, and no one was allowed to enter or leave the buildings.
